@ozen-ui/kit
Version:
React component library
20 lines (19 loc) • 861 B
JavaScript
Object.defineProperty(exports, "__esModule", { value: true });
exports.useOzenThemeContext = exports.OzenThemeContext = exports.OzenThemeContextDefaultValue = void 0;
var react_1 = require("react");
var environment_1 = require("../../../../constants/environment");
var constants_1 = require("./constants");
exports.OzenThemeContextDefaultValue = {
theme: constants_1.OZEN_THEME_PROVIDER_DEFAULT_THEME,
settings: {
isUseNewProvider: false,
},
};
exports.OzenThemeContext = (0, react_1.createContext)(exports.OzenThemeContextDefaultValue);
var useOzenThemeContext = function () { return (0, react_1.useContext)(exports.OzenThemeContext); };
exports.useOzenThemeContext = useOzenThemeContext;
// Именованный провайдер
if (environment_1.isDev) {
exports.OzenThemeContext.displayName = 'OzenThemeContext';
}
;